Linux
xmonad

XmonadでJavaのGUIアプリケーションが正常に動作しない場合

More than 5 years have passed since last update.

コンポーネントの表示領域がやけに小さい、メニューバーをクリックしてもメニューがすぐに消えてしまう、等の事象への対応。

こちらに解答がある。

http://xmonad.org/xmonad-docs/xmonad-contrib/XMonad-Hooks-SetWMName.html

~/.xmonad/xmonad.hsを以下のように編集する。

import XMonad

import XMonad.Hooks.SetWMName -- これを追記

main = do
xmonad $ defaultConfig
{
startupHook = setWMName "LG3D" -- これを追記
}

そして、$ xmonad --recompileで設定を再コンパイルし、Super + qでXmonadを再起動する。